THERE ARE SAFETY ISSUES HERE - READ MY NOTES HERE Somebody gave me their old microwave so I decided to take it apart to see if there was anything inside that I could make use of before it goes to the local tip/recycling center. I have no use for the magnetron although there are a few videos on YouTube using them. I might strip out the magnets and use them on their own (see the video link below about the dangers). The two motors are both AC but may still be useful. The large transformer may have some use. The large capacitor scares me as it has the potential to be DANGEROUS and must be handled with care. The main circuit board has a transformer on it and a relay I think, plus various discrete components. The item I couldn't identify in the video is a thermal cutout that should shut off the power if the oven overheats.
